Adidas Outdoor Re-Signs Climber Kai Lightner To Athlete Team
Adidas Outdoor USA has re-signed climber Kai Lightner, 18, to the company’s team of athletes. Lightner is a 10-time national champion in the USA Climbing youth circuit and won four Pan American Championship titles. Last year, Lightner took first and second place in the adult lead and bouldering national championships as one of the youngest competitors in the field.
Dick’s Sporting Goods To Open Four New Stores In May
Dick’s Sporting Goods will be open four new Dick’s Sporting Goods stores in May. The stores are in Aurora, CO (grand opening ceremonies are May 19-20), West Long Branch, NJ (May 25-27), Gurnee, IL (May 25-27), and McAllen, TX (May 25-27).

NSSF’s Board Votes To Expel Dick’s Sporting Goods
The National Shooting Sports Foundation (NSSF), the trade association for the firearms, ammunition, hunting and shooting sports industries, said the foundation’s Board of Governors unanimously voted to expel Dick’s Sporting Goods from membership for conduct detrimental to the best interests of the Foundation.
